The demand for enhanced fire safety in materials is universal across many industries. Phosphorus-based flame retardants (PFRs) have emerged as highly effective, versatile, and increasingly preferred solutions for imparting this critical property. Their unique mechanisms of action and favorable environmental profiles make them suitable for a broad spectrum of applications. For procurement managers and R&D professionals, understanding where and how to effectively deploy PFRs is key to developing safer, compliant products.

2. Automotive Industry:
Vehicle interiors, including seating foams, dashboard materials, and wiring insulation, are often made from polymers that require flame retardancy to meet automotive safety regulations. PFRs are widely used in:
The automotive sector demands durability and performance under various conditions, making the synergistic effects of PFRs particularly valuable. R&D scientists often seek PFRs that offer good thermal stability and minimal impact on mechanical properties.
